Frequently Asked Questions
Peanut butter bars are a delicious dessert treat similar to brownies, but with a blonde or lighter-colored base. They are made with a combination of ingredients like peanut butter, brown sugar, butter, flour, and eggs, resulting in a dense and chewy texture.
Absolutely! While peanut butter is the classic choice, you can substitute other nut butters like almond butter or cashew butter in the recipe. The flavor and texture of the blondies may vary slightly, but they should still turn out delicious.
Once cooled, you can store peanut butter bars in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3-4 days. If you’d like to extend their shelf life, you can store them in the refrigerator for up to a week. For longer storage, individually wrap the blondies in plastic wrap or foil and freeze them for up to 2-3 months.

Peanut Butter Bars
Ingredients
- ⅓ cup unsalted butter melted
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 2 eggs large
- ½ teaspoon pure vanilla extract
- ¾ cup all-purpose flour
- ½ teaspoon baking powder
- ½ teaspoon salt
- 3 tablespoons crunchy peanut butter
- ¼ cup salted peanuts
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350 degrees F. (175 degrees C.).
- While the oven is preheating, prepare your 8-inch square baking pan. Grease it thoroughly with butter or non-stick cooking spray. Make sure all inside surfaces of the pan are well coated to prevent your blondies from sticking.
- In a large mixing bowl, combine the ⅓ cup of melted butter and 1 cup of granulated sugar. Stir them together until they’re fully combined.
- Next, add in the 2 large eggs and ½ teaspoon of vanilla extract to the butter and sugar mixture. Stir the mixture well to ensure that the eggs and vanilla are fully incorporated.
- In a separate mixing bowl, combine the ¾ cup of all-purpose flour, ½ teaspoon of baking powder, and ½ teaspoon of salt. Mix these dry ingredients together to evenly distribute the baking powder and salt throughout the flour.
-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ients. Stir to combine them but avoid overmixing. The mixture should be smooth and free of lumps.
- Add the 3 tablespoons of crunchy peanut butter to the mixture. Stir it in until it’s evenly distributed throughout the batter.
- Pour the batter into the prepared baking pan. Use a spatula to spread the batter evenly across the pan.
- Sprinkle the ¼ cup of salted peanuts over the top of the batter. Make sure the peanuts are distributed evenly.
- Place the pan in the preheated oven. Bake the blondies for about 30 minutes. The blondies are done when the edges start to pull away from the sides of the pan.
- After baking, remove the pan from the oven and allow the blondies to cool in the pan for at least 10 minutes.
Notes
- The salted peanut on top really make these amazing! The texture of these bars is so good, it’s dense like a brownie but it isn’t chocolate. You are going to love them.
- You can use creamy peanut butter if you don’t have chunky though the texture of the chunky is nice in these peanut butter bars.
